Martins develops a conspiracy theory after learning of a "third man" present at the time of Harry's death, running into interference from British officer Major Calloway, and falling head-over-heels for … WebApr 30, 2024 · These hand carved clocks have nature or hunting scenes. Often there is a Stag with horns, carved leaves, birds, hunting horns or guns. Generally they are natural, unpainted wood, although some will have other moving figures that may be painted. The cuckoo peeps out at the top from behind his door.

WebSep 22, 2024 · The cuckoo clock. " - Harry Lime, 'The Third Man' Orson Welles' character in the 1949 film The Third Man was not the only one confused about the origins of the cuckoo clock. In fact, many think the cuckoo clock comes from Switzerland, but it's more likely that it originated in the village of Schönwald in Germany. god of evil nameWebCuckoo Clock Speech Analysis.
